Will my dog be OK if he drank alcohol?

Just like chocolate and onions, alcohol is toxic to dogs. Even small amounts of alcohol — not only in drinks but also in syrups and raw bread dough — can have ingredients that are poisonous for them.

What happens if a dog licks alcohol?

It is the isopropanol based products that produce severe and sometimes fatal results. When your dog ingests isopropanol based alcohol it is absorbed rapidly, is especially toxic to your dog, and can produce life threatening symptoms within thirty minutes.

What happens if a dog licks rubbing alcohol?

Isopropyl Alcohol (or rubbing alcohol): If ingested by pets, isopropyl alcohol can cause vomiting, disorientation, incoordination, and in severe cases, collapse, respiratory depression and seizures. Rubbing alcohol should not be used at home on a pet’s skin.

Is Whiskey bad for your liver?

Because your liver breaks down alcohol in your body, heavy drinking can lead to liver disease. High amounts of alcohol cause fatty deposits in your liver and scarring, which can eventually cause liver failure.

What does beer do to dogs?

Another reason beer – and alcohol in general – is so dangerous to dogs is because it can cause a sudden and dramatic drop in blood sugar. After ingesting alcohol, a dog may need medically administered glucose to avoid loss of consciousness, seizures or even irreparable brain damage.

Is it bad for a dog to drink alcohol?

Just like chocolate and onions, alcohol is toxic to dogs. Even small amounts of alcohol — not only in drinks but also in syrups and raw bread dough — can have ingredients that are poisonous for them. Both ethanol (the intoxicating agent in beer, wine and liquor) and hops (used to brew beer) can cause dogs alcohol intoxication.
